Yatsen Holding Limited (YSG)

USD 4.4

(-5.38%)

Annual Balance Sheets

(In CNY)
Breakdown 2023 2022 2021 2020 2019 2018
Total Assets 5 Billion 5.86 Billion 7.27 Billion 8.3 Billion 2.01 Billion 328.22 Million
Total Current Assets 2.95 Billion 3.5 Billion 4.55 Billion 7.08 Billion 1.57 Billion 287.95 Million
Cash And Short Term Investments 2.05 Billion 2.58 Billion 3.13 Billion 5.72 Billion 686.57 Million 25.06 Million
Cash and Cash Equivalents 836.88 Million 1.51 Billion 3.13 Billion 5.72 Billion 676.57 Million 25.06 Million
Short Term Investments 1.21 Billion 1.07 Billion 62.87 Million 35.02 Million 10 Million 345 Thousand
Net Receivables 306.02 Million 206.49 Million 355.89 Million 433.68 Million 292.98 Million 155.84 Million
Inventory 352.09 Million 423.28 Million 695.76 Million 616.8 Million 504.04 Million 87.49 Million
Other Current Assets 55.8 Million 292.82 Million 366.19 Million 304.64 Million 10.03 Million 334 Thousand
Total Non-Current Assets 2.05 Billion 2.35 Billion 2.71 Billion 1.21 Billion 438.49 Million 40.26 Million
Net PPE 179.22 Million 208.62 Million 668.28 Million 822 Million 372.75 Million 23.42 Million
Good Will And Intangible Assets 1.22 Billion 1.54 Billion 1.61 Billion 209.68 Million 30.62 Million 1.11 Million
Good Will 556.56 Million 857.14 Million 869.42 Million 20.59 Million 20.59 Million -
Intangible Assets 671.39 Million 689.66 Million 745.85 Million 189.09 Million 10.02 Million 1.11 Million
Long-Term Investments 618.75 Million 502.57 Million 350.38 Million 34.86 Million 29.67 Million 3 Million
Tax Assets 1.37 Million 1.95 Million 2 Million 597 Thousand 4.23 Million 646 Thousand
Other Non Current Assets 27.1 Million 94.26 Million 80.22 Million 152.05 Million 1.2 Million 12.07 Million
Other Assets - - - - - -
Total Liabilities 821.24 Million 800.13 Million 1.26 Billion 1.44 Billion 936.13 Million 198.8 Million
Total Current Liabilities 611.32 Million 588.41 Million 877.58 Million 1.13 Billion 763.34 Million 187.26 Million
Account Payables 105.69 Million 119.84 Million 240.81 Million 466.7 Million 400.54 Million 90.22 Million
Tax Payables 35.49 Million 21.82 Million 16.74 Million 18.68 Million 136.68 Million 19.27 Million
Short Term Debt 45.46 Million 79.58 Million 214.84 Million 215.3 Million 93.91 Million 11.22 Million
Deferred Revenue 41.57 Million 16.65 Million 20.68 Million 6.22 Million 3.17 Million 1000.00
Other Current Liabilities 418.59 Million 372.32 Million 401.24 Million 442.44 Million 265.7 Million 85.81 Million
Total Non Current Liabilities 209.91 Million 211.71 Million 386.93 Million 313.46 Million 172.78 Million 11.54 Million
Long-Term Debt 67.76 Million 52.99 Million 206.3 Million 311.91 Million 171.04 Million 11.54 Million
Deferred Revenue Non Current 30.55 Million 45.28 Million 56.18 Million -1.55 Million -1.74 Million -
Deferred Tax Liabilities Non Current - - - - - -
Other Non Current Liabilities - - - 1.55 Million 1.74 Million -
Other Liabilities - - - - - -
Total Equity 4.18 Billion 5.06 Billion 6 Billion 6.86 Billion 1.07 Billion 129.41 Million
Stock Holders Equity 4.13 Billion 4.71 Billion 5.65 Billion 6.84 Billion 1.07 Billion 129.41 Million
Common Stock 173 Thousand 173 Thousand 173 Thousand 173 Thousand 56 Thousand 47 Thousand
Retained Earnings -7.34 Billion -6.6 Billion -5.78 Billion -4.24 Billion -89.59 Million -59.98 Million
Accumulated other comprehensive income 84.37 Million -50.01 Million -234.42 Million -77.21 Million 33.75 Million 610 Thousand
Common Stock Equity 4.13 Billion 4.71 Billion 5.65 Billion 6.84 Billion 1.07 Billion 129.41 Million
Capital Lease Obligation 113.23 Million 132.58 Million 421.14 Million 527.21 Million 264.96 Million 19.87 Million
Total Investments 1.83 Billion 1.57 Billion 350.38 Million 34.86 Million 10 Million 3 Million
Total Debt 113.23 Million 132.58 Million 421.14 Million 527.21 Million 264.96 Million 22.77 Million
Net Debt -723.65 Million -1.38 Billion -2.71 Billion -5.19 Billion -411.61 Million -2.28 Million

Balance Sheet Charts